Despite a regulatory and geopolitical landscape marked by uncertainty, business leaders are actively advancing their climate transition planning. Early initiatives—such as the Transition Plan Taskforce and legal requirements like the EU’s Corporate Sustainablity Reporting Directive and IFRS—are part of a rich landscape of voluntary and mandatory frameworks for transition planning.

In 2025, early learnings and practices have started to emerge, yet companies still face significant challenges in shaping and operationalizing their transition plans.
